Edens Zero is about a boy named Shiki Granbell who lives alone on a deserted planet. One day, he meets Rebecca Bluegarden, a B-Cuber who came to his world looking for content for her B-Cube channel (basically their universe’s version of YouTube).
Together, they set out to look for a mysterious being called Mother who can supposedly grant wishes. Along the way, they obtain a ship that once belonged to Shiki’s adoptive grandfather. The ship is called Edens Zero.

What Is Edens Zero: Season 2 About?
The first season of Edens Zero covers Volumes 1-8 of the manga. It ends with the death of Valkyrie and Homura taking her place in the Four Shining Stars.
Volume 9 is about the Edens Zero crew facing off against Drakken Joe. They head off to the Belial Gore but soon get found out. Drakken then sends teams of infiltrators and elemental special force units to deal with them.
Which Studio Is Making Edens Zero: Season 2?
Kodansha and Nippon Television Music will once again be co-producing Edens Zero. However, the third producer, Magic Capsule, is backing out of the anime. Instead Magic Bus, another anime production company, will be stepping in. The animation studio remains unchanged though, J.C. Staff will continue their work with Edens Zero: Season 2.
Kodansha is an incredibly well-known anime producer that started in 1909. It’s the company behind Attack on Titan, Your Lie In April, and Hiro Mashima’s other hit, Fairy Tail.
Nippon Television Music has been in business since 1969 but has only helped produce a handful of anime including Flying Witch and Chihayafuru: Season 3.
Magic Bus has been producing anime since 1972 and is known for its adult anime releases. Although they do have experience producing TV anime in the past, these include How A Realist Hero Rebuilt The Kingdom and And Yet The Town Moves.
J.C. Staff is another classic name in anime. They’ve been animating shows since 1986 including Toradora! and Food Wars!
The director of the first season, Yūshi Suzuki, sadly passed away right before the season finale. Season 2 will now be directed by Toshinori Watanabe, who was part of the storyboard team of Season 1.
